认识JSONP

原理:

  1. 动态创建script标签并插入dom
  2. 设置script标签src为需要请求的资源地址
  3. 为script的src添加一个参数,为前后端约定的参数,是一个回调
  4. 后台返回的数据会调用这个回调
  5. 前端需要在页面中声明这个方法
  6. 后台返回回调后会调用这个方法
  7. 方法携带的参数为前台所需要的数据
    图1-1

    图1-1所示
    __jp0为前后端约定的统一参数,0为自增数,保证每次请求回调不同。
最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容

  • JSONP 从这一部分开始了解一下前后端分离的思想:javascript高级部分:前后端联动,浏览器+服务器 数据...
    如梦初醒Tel阅读 4,743评论 0 0
  • Swift1> Swift和OC的区别1.1> Swift没有地址/指针的概念1.2> 泛型1.3> 类型严谨 对...
    cosWriter阅读 13,798评论 1 32
  • AJAX 原生js操作ajax 1.创建XMLHttpRequest对象 var xhr = new XMLHtt...
    碧玉含香阅读 8,609评论 0 7
  • 点击查看原文 Web SDK 开发手册 SDK 概述 网易云信 SDK 为 Web 应用提供一个完善的 IM 系统...
    layjoy阅读 14,738评论 0 15
  • 浏览器基于安全(用户隐私)考虑,不允许不同域名的网站之间互相调用ajax,只是不允许ajax,其他的还是允许的。但...
    学的会的前端阅读 3,914评论 0 3